Eight Detroit Tigers Executives Accused of Misconduct Since 2023
Since 2023, at least eight men affiliated with the Detroit Tigers, including four vice presidents and two other high-ranking employees, have been accused of misconduct toward women, according to a detailed investigation by The Athletic. The allegations range from offensive comments and verbal harassment to physical confrontations, including one instance where a former vice president allegedly pushed a female coworker down a flight of stairs. Six of the accused have resigned, been fired, or did not have their contracts renewed, with others suspended as investigations continue. Women employees described a hostile workplace culture at Ilitch Sports & Entertainment, the company operating the Tigers and other Detroit sports entities, where women were advised on dress codes to avoid distracting men and routinely faced inappropriate comments. The organization has faced at least three federal lawsuits alleging age discrimination, highlighting broader concerns about workplace culture and accountability. Despite public scrutiny and media coverage, the Tigers organization has yet to issue an official statement addressing the misconduct allegations.
